How do you add fragrance oil to hand sanitizer?

Mix aloe vera gel, optional glycerin, and rubbing alcohol in a small bowl. Add fragrance oils of your choice. Mix well and add distilled water (or colloidal/ionic silver) to thin to desired consistency. Use a small funnel or medicine dropper to transfer hand sanitizer into spray or pump type bottles.

How do you add fragrance to alcohol?

Learning how to add fragrance to isopropyl alcohol is very simple process.
  1. Pour 6 ounces of isopropyl alcohol into a glass beaker. ...
  2. Add 1/4 tsp., or about 10 to 15 drops, of essential oil or fragrance oil to the isopropyl alcohol.
  3. Stir the mixture slowly and completely, until the fragrance is fully dispersed.
